In recent years, Bitcoin has become a popular investment option for many individuals. As the cryptocurrency market continues to grow, investors are looking for ways to incorporate Bitcoin into their retirement portfolios. One common question that arises is whether or not one can use a 401k to buy Bitcoin. In this article, we will explore the topic and provide you with the necessary information to make an informed decision.
Firstly, it is important to understand what a 401k is. A 401k is a retirement savings plan offered by employers in the United States. It allows employees to contribute a portion of their income to a tax-deferred retirement account. Contributions to a 401k are made with pre-tax dollars, which means that the money is not subject to income tax until it is withdrawn during retirement.
The question of whether or not you can use your 401k to buy Bitcoin is a complex one. The answer depends on the specific rules and regulations of your 401k plan. While some 401k plans may allow you to invest in alternative assets such as Bitcoin, others may not.
Can I use 401k to buy Bitcoin? The answer is that it is possible, but it is not a straightforward process. One way to invest your 401k in Bitcoin is by using a self-directed IRA. A self-directed IRA is a type of individual retirement account that allows you to invest in a wider range of assets, including cryptocurrencies.
To use your 401k to buy Bitcoin through a self-directed IRA, you will need to follow these steps:
1. Roll over your 401k to a self-directed IRA: This involves transferring the funds from your 401k to a self-directed IRA. You can do this by rolling over your 401k directly to the self-directed IRA custodian or by transferring the funds to a traditional IRA and then rolling them over to the self-directed IRA.
2. Choose a self-directed IRA custodian: A self-directed IRA custodian is responsible for holding and managing your retirement funds. It is important to choose a reputable custodian that specializes in self-directed IRAs and has experience with cryptocurrency investments.
3. Open a cryptocurrency brokerage account: Once your self-directed IRA is set up, you will need to open a cryptocurrency brokerage account. This account will allow you to buy and sell c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in.
4. Invest your self-directed IRA funds in Bitcoin: Finally, you can use the funds in your self-directed IRA to buy Bitcoin through your cryptocurrency brokerage account.
While it is possible to use your 401k to buy Bitcoin, there are some important considerations to keep in mind. First, it is important to understand the risks associated with investing in cryptocurrencies. The cryptocurrency market is highly volatile, and Bitcoin has experienced significant price fluctuations in the past. Investing a portion of your retirement savings in Bitcoin could potentially lead to significant gains, but it could also result in substantial losses.
Secondly, it is important to note that not all self-directed IRA custodians offer cryptocurrency investment options. Before rolling over your 401k to a self-directed IRA, make sure that the custodian you choose supports cryptocurrency investments.
In conclusion, the answer to the question "Can I use 401k to buy Bitcoin?" is yes, but it requires a few steps and careful consideration. By rolling over your 401k to a self-directed IRA and investing in Bitcoin through a cryptocurrency brokerage account, you can incorporate Bitcoin into your retirement portfolio. However, it is crucial to weigh the potential risks and benefits before making this decision.
